House Equity Loan What's the distinction in between a cash-out re-finance and taking a home equity loan? Well, with a cash-out re-finance, you settle your existing home mortgage and participate in a brand-new one. With a house equity loan, you are getting a 2nd home mortgage in addition to your original one, suggesting that you now have two liens on your home, which equates as having two different financial institutions, each with a possible claim on your home.
If you require a considerable amount for a specific purpose, home equity credit can be beneficial. However, if you can get a lower interest rate with a cash-out refinanceand you plan to remain in your home for the long termthe refinance probably makes more sense. In both cases, ensure of your capability to repay because, otherwise, you could wind up losing your house.
